    GATE Chemical Engineering Cut Off 2026: IIT Guwahati has released the GATE chemical engineering 2026 cutoff through the result. This year, GATE CE 2026 cutoff for the general category is 25. Aspirants who cross the GATE 2026 cutoff are only eligible for admission to NIT, IIT, IIITs and GITs. The cut-off marks represent the minimum qualifying marks decided by the conducting authority for each paper and category. The GATE 2026 result has been declared on March 19.     GATE Chemical Engineering Qualifying Marks 2026

    The authority released the GATE 2026 CH qualifying cutoff thoguh result. Candidates can check the cutoff for GATE 2026 chemical engineering in the table below.

    GATE 2026 CH qualifying cutoff

    GATE Chemical Engineering Cut off 2026 Category WiseGATE 2026 Cutoff

    GATE Chemical Engineering cut off 2026 for general

    25

    GATE Chemical Engineering cut off 2026 for OBC

    22.5

    GATE Chemical Engineering cut off 2026 for SC/ST

    16.6

    How to Calculate GATE 2026 Score?

    After evaluating the answers, the actual (raw) marks obtained by a candidate will be considered for computing the GATE score. For multi-session test papers, the raw marks obtained by the candidates in different sessions will be converted to normalized marks for that particular test paper. Thus, raw marks (for single session test papers) or normalized marks (for multi-session test papers) will be used for computing the GATE score, based on the qualifying marks.

    Calculation of GATE Score for All Papers

    The GATE 2026 score will be computed using the formula given below.

    1771756004355

    Where,

    ? is the marks obtained by the candidate (actual marks for single session papers and normalized marks for multi-session papers);

    ?q is the qualifying marks for the General Category candidate in the paper;

    ?t is the mean of marks of top 0.1% or top 10 (whichever is larger) of the candidates who appeared in the paper (in case of multi-session papers including all sessions);

    ?q = 350 is the score assigned to ?q ; and

    ?t = 900 is the score assigned to ?t .

    Factors Affecting GATE 2026 Cutoff

    The GATE 2026 cutoff depends on a number of important determinants which include: the level of difficulty of the exam, the number of test-takers, and availability of seats.

    • Students performance in the GATE exam

    • Number of students appearing in the GATE exam

    • Number of seats available

    • Difficulty level of the GATE exam

    • Previous year cutoff
